What's The Definition Of Dazzled?

[adj] stupefied or dizzied by something overpowering; "I fall back dazzled at beholding myself all rosy red, / At having, I myself, caused the sun to rise."- `Chanticler' by Rostand
[adj] having vision overcome temporarily by or as if by intense light; "she shut her dazzled eyes against the sun's brilliance"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Dazzled: blind | confused | unsighted
